Faced with signing up with a frantically long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ham selected online counselling rather. “I just felt that I couldn’t wait any longer– I was motivated and ready to deal with my issues and rather liked the concept of doing so in the convenience of my own house,” said the 29-year-old, who lives in London. After an online search, he discovered a therapist whose profile fit his requirements and reserved a chat session for the next day.
Remote, text-based counselling is growing in popularity in the UK. The physician app Babylon offers treatment to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service BetterHelp also has actually 150,000 registered U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with a lot of in the United States.

Buckley stated patients must inspect services’ privacy policies before registering. “Not all online counselling websites utilize expertly trained therapists or adhere to a principles policy, so ask your GP for a suggestion in the first instance. Just like all kinds of services and assistance, what works for one person may not work for another person,” he stated.
Marc Bush, chief policy advisor at Young Minds, stated that while online counselling services are valuable, “they shouldn’t replace in person treatment with a skilled professional. If a young person is having a hard time, we would motivate them to speak with their GP in the very first instance, or to get in touch with a recognized service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.
For Rackham, who has actually generalised stress and anxiety disorder, online counselling wasn’t the best fit. “I felt it was near impossible for the therapist to really get a sense of the issues I was dealing with,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I think I understood after that online session how vital interpersonal interaction was.
